Hard Water Effects on Plumbing and Solutions
Hard water, an usual issue in several families, can have significant influence on plumbing systems. Recognizing these effects is critical for maintaining the durability and efficiency of your pipes and components.

Introduction


Hard water is water which contains high degrees of d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ium. These minerals are safe to human wellness however can ruin plumbing facilities with time. Let's delve into exactly how tough water affects pipes and what you can do regarding it.

Effect on Water lines


Tough water affects pipes in several harmful methods, mostly with range build-up, lowered water circulation, and raised deterioration.

Range Accumulation


One of the most common issues caused by hard water is range build-up inside pipelines and fixtures. As water flows via the pipes system, minerals speed up out and abide by the pipe walls. With time, this build-up can narrow pipe openings, bring about minimized water flow and raised stress on the system.

Decreased Water Circulation


Mineral deposits from tough water can slowly reduce the size of pipes, limiting water flow to taps, showers, and appliances. This minimized flow not just affects water pressure yet also raises energy usage as devices like water heaters need to work more difficult to supply the same amount of warm water.

What is Hard Water?


Hard water is characterized by its mineral content, specifically cal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als go into the water as it percolates via sedimentary rock and chalk down payments underground. When tough water is heated or left to stand, it often tends to develop range, a crusty accumulation that abides by surfaces and can create a variety of concerns in pipes systems.

Corrosion


While hard water minerals themselves do not cause corrosion, they can intensify existing corrosion issues in pipelines. Range build-up can catch water against metal surface areas, increasing the rust process and potentially leading to leakages or pipe failure with time.

Home appliance Damage


Past pipelines, hard water can additionally damage household devices linked to the supply of water. Devices such as water heaters, dishwashers, and cleaning machines are especially vulnerable to range buildup. This can reduce their performance, boost maintenance expenses, and reduce their lifespan.

Testing and Treatment


Evaluating for difficult water and carrying out ideal therapy actions is vital to alleviating its effects on pipes and home appliances.

Water Conditioners


Water softeners are one of the most common option for treating hard water. They function by trading cal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, efficiently decreasing the firmness of the water.

Other Therapy Options


Along with water softeners, various other treatment alternatives cons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each method has its benefits and viability relying on the seriousness of the difficult water trouble and home requirements.

The Impact of Hard Water on Your Plumbing System and Solutions

  • Understanding Hard Water. Hard water contains high levels of minerals, particularly calcium and magnesium, which are naturally present in the water supply. When hard water flows through your plumbing system, these minerals can accumulate over time, causing various issues. This mineral buildup, known as scale, can clog pipes, reduce water flow, and impair the efficiency of plumbing fixtures and appliances.


  • Recognizing the Signs of Hard Water. To determine if you have hard water, there are several signs to look out for. These include soap scum residue on surfaces, stained fixtures, reduced water flow, and increased energy bills. If you notice these signs in your Dallas home, it is likely that you are dealing with hard water issues.


  • The Impact of Hard Water on Plumbing Fixtures and Appliances. Hard water can have detrimental effects on plumbing fixtures and appliances. The accumulation of mineral deposits can lead to reduced lifespan, decreased efficiency, clogged pipes, and increased maintenance and repair costs. Over time, these issues can result in costly repairs and replacements if not addressed promptly.


  • Solutions for Hard Water Issues. There are effective solutions available to combat the impact of hard water on your plumbing system in Dallas. Consider the following options:

  • Water Softeners: Water softeners are devices that remove the minerals responsible for hardness from the water. By installing a water softener, such as the ones provided by Metro-Flow Plumbing, you can enjoy the benefits of softened water throughout your Dallas home. Water softeners work by utilizing a process called ion exchange to replace the cal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, effectively reducing the hardness of the water. Softened water not only helps prevent scale buildup but also leaves your skin and hair feeling smoother, prolongs the lifespan of your plumbing fixtures and appliances, and reduces the need for excessive cleaning.


  • Descaling Agents: Descaling agents are products specifically designed to dissolve and remove mineral deposits from plumbing fixtures and appliances. These agents can be effective in addressing existing scale buildup and preventing further accumulation. When using descaling agents, it’s important to follow the instructions provided and take necessary precautions to ensure safety.
